WebJun 12, 2024 · Rotate balloon and repeat dip two more times, to create a petal like pattern. Shake off excess chocolate from the bottom. Place upright or at an angle (the direction will determine the shape of the finished bowl) on a rimmed ba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Repeat process for additional bowls. WebSep 24, 2024 · 4 African Violet. The African violet is commonly grown as a colorful houseplant. Native to the eastern topical parts of Africa, these colorful plants are only hardy outdoors in USDA Zone 12. Thriving in pots and containers, African violets typically flower in shades of blue and purple. WebJan 11, 2024 · Peace Lily. Blaine Moats.
